Deck 5: Router and Ios Basics
1
You can access the system configuration dialog by typing the ____ command at the privileged EXEC prompt.

A) init
B) config
C) dialog
D) setup
D
2
The editing command ____ moves the cursor to the end of the current line.

A) Ctrl+E
B) Ctrl+F
C) Esc+B
D) Esc+F
A
3
The ____ command is typically used as a legal means of warning anyone who accesses the banner that they will be held accountable.

A) banner legal
B) legal motd
C) banner motd
D) motd on
C
